i have fished up to six people out of my boat at one time, and i always seen to it that each person had submersible light. my experience (and my opinion) has been that the amount of light in the boat or lights shining in the water dont affect the bite. i dont know if the full moon does anything but it seems the bite is slower than on the darker nights. its the plankton that migrates to the light and the minnows that come for the plankton that draws the crappie and other species that feed on minnows in.
